"The Honey Cart"

A poem about John Riley

The night was dark and stormy,

John Riley took a fit,

The wind blew out his candle,

And he fell among the s---.

 

Oh gimme back me candle

Gimme back me light

Gimme back me shovel

Till I shove away the s----.

 

"My mother, Kate Colleary, could remember old folk singing this song."

Contributed by Billy O'Byrne.
